Browse Source

适用性调整

jz.kai 2 years ago
parent
commit
e1a82ece23

+ 2 - 0
common/src/main/java/com/jpsoft/prices/modules/sys/dao/DataDictionaryDAO.java

@@ -29,4 +29,6 @@ public interface DataDictionaryDAO {
 	DataDictionary findByCatalogNameAndValue(String catalogName,String value);
 
     DataDictionary findByName(String name);
+
+	List<DataDictionary> findByExtended(String extended1);
 }

+ 2 - 0
common/src/main/java/com/jpsoft/prices/modules/sys/service/DataDictionaryService.java

@@ -24,4 +24,6 @@ public interface DataDictionaryService {
 	String findNameByCatalogNameAndValue(String catalogName,String value);
 	DataDictionary findByCatalogNameAndValue(String catalogName,String value);
     DataDictionary findByName(String name);
+
+	List<DataDictionary> findByExtended(String extended1);
 }

+ 5 - 0
common/src/main/java/com/jpsoft/prices/modules/sys/service/impl/DataDictionaryServiceImpl.java

@@ -115,4 +115,9 @@ public class DataDictionaryServiceImpl implements DataDictionaryService {
 	public DataDictionary findByName(String name) {
 		return dataDictionaryDAO.findByName(name);
 	}
+
+	@Override
+	public List<DataDictionary> findByExtended(String extended1) {
+		return dataDictionaryDAO.findByExtended(extended1);
+	}
 }

+ 6 - 0
common/src/main/resources/mapper/sys/DataDictionary.xml

@@ -210,4 +210,10 @@
     <select id="findByName" resultMap="DataDictionaryMap">
         select * from sys_data_dictionary where name_=#{0} limit 1;
     </select>
+    <select id="findByExtended" resultMap="DataDictionaryMap">
+        select * from sys_data_dictionary
+        where del_flag = 0
+        and extended_1 = #{0}
+        order by sort_no asc
+    </select>
 </mapper>

+ 1 - 1
web/src/main/java/com/jpsoft/prices/modules/common/controller/PlansController.java

@@ -54,7 +54,7 @@ public class PlansController {
     }
 
     /**
-     * 计重方案(油价浮动
+     * 计重方案(里程
      */
     public static BigDecimal weightPlanC(Standard standard, BigDecimal weight, BigDecimal distance){
         BigDecimal val = new BigDecimal(0);

+ 19 - 0
web/src/main/java/com/jpsoft/prices/modules/sys/controller/DataDictionaryController.java

@@ -402,4 +402,23 @@ public class DataDictionaryController {
 
         return msgResult;
     }
+
+    @PostMapping("findByExtended")
+    @ApiOperation(value = "查询数据列表")
+    public MessageResult<List> findByExtended(String extended1){
+        MessageResult<List> messageResult = new MessageResult<>();
+
+        try {
+            List<DataDictionary> list = dataDictionaryService.findByExtended(extended1);
+
+            messageResult.setResult(true);
+            messageResult.setData(list);
+        }
+        catch (Exception ex){
+            messageResult.setResult(false);
+            messageResult.setMessage(ex.getMessage());
+        }
+
+        return messageResult;
+    }
 }